One of the many advantages to owning a Weimaraner is the breed's versatility. Not only can they participate in many different activities, but can excel in about anything they attempt. D O G A G I L I T Y (for further information) ![]() Dog agility is a competitive sport where your dog navigates through an obstacle course in a race against the clock. The teamwork of agility is an excellent way to strengthen the bond with your dog. C O N F O R M A T I O N (for further information) Conformation judging is how we keep our breed looking like our breed. We
have a certain breed standard that describes what a Weimaraner should look
and act like. At AKC shows, judges try to find the dogs that best represent
the standard and award them championship points. When a dog has
earned the
required 15 points, it is named an AKC Champion - a very worthy
accomplishment.H U N T I N G / R E T R I E V I N G (for further information) The Weimaraner is a pointing dog, bred initially
in Germany as a hunter of small game. As game became less available the Weimaraner was
bred as a bird dog and in North America is used primarily to hunt upland game birds. Even
if you don't plan on hunting with your Weimaraner you can participate in the Weimaraner
Club of America's Rating Tests for Shooting & Retrieving abilities. The Weimaraner, of
course, has innate abilities in these areas and is a pleasure to watch and handle in these

T H E R A P Y D O G (for further information) "Visiting Pets" "Therapy Dogs" "Therapy Pets" are just some of the names given to describe programs in which animals help people just by visiting with them. Visiting with animals can help people feel less lonely, and less depressed. An animal visit can offer entertainment, or a welcome distraction from pain and infirmity. Several of our club members actively participate with their Weimaraners in local Therapy Dog Programs. T R A C K I N G (for further information) Tracking, as AKC defines it, is a competition form of canine search and rescue. It is a sport that allows your dog to demonstrate their natural ability to recognize and follow human scent. |
